Rain-Kissed Shillong: Discover the City’s Hidden Magic This Monsoon


Updated: June 01, 2025 23:40

Image Source: Youtube
The monsoon has arrived early in Shillong this year, and the city is putting on a show only nature can script. If you love the sound of rain, the scent of wet earth, and landscapes that look straight out of a painting, this is the season to discover Shillong’s enchanting beauty.
 
Key Highlights:
 
Nature in Full Bloom: June marks the start of the monsoon, with temperatures between 18°C and 25°C. The hills are alive with fresh greenery, wildflowers, and the dramatic rise of waterfalls like Elephant Falls and Sweet Falls.
 
Misty, Magical Mornings: Expect cloud-kissed mornings and evenings, with the city’s valleys and pine forests often veiled in thick, rolling mist. The rain transforms every corner into a tranquil retreat, perfect for peaceful walks and quiet reflection.
 
Waterfall Wonders: The rains swell Shillong’s famous waterfalls, making them thunderous and breathtaking. Cherrapunji and Mawsynram, nearby, are at their wildest and most beautiful, holding the title of the wettest places on Earth.
 
Off-Season Perks: June sees fewer tourists, so you get Shillong’s charm almost to yourself. Hotels and homestays offer great discounts, and local markets are less crowded, letting you soak in the city’s culture at your own pace.
 
Travel Tips: Carry waterproof gear and keep your plans flexible—heavy rain can cause travel delays and occasional landslides. Local authorities advise checking weather updates and road conditions before heading out.
 
Outlook:
With its lush hills, vibrant waterfalls, and cozy cafes, Shillong in the monsoon is a sensory delight. Just bring an umbrella, a sense of adventure, and let the rain show you a softer, greener side of the city.
